Home Depot Energy Analyst in Atlanta, Georgia
Position Purpose:
The Energy Analyst position will play a key support role in The Home Depot's energy management efforts. The position will identify, distinguish and analyze multiple components of a problem and then make conclusions using high-level quantitative skills to help drive projects and bring value to the Home Depot through energy management operations. Participate in driving operations processes for specific areas of responsibilities and complete project tasks as assigned by managers.
Key Responsibilities:
30% Utilize energy management system data tools to pro actively identify lighting, HVAC, and electrical issues at stores causing either comfort or energy efficiency issues. Create analysis measuring effectiveness of multiple projects expected to reduce energy spend. Resolve issues related to store utility accounts.
20% Identify and report on problematic stores using load profile interval data as well as monthly bill data. Synthesize data from utility bill database to support evaluation of potential new energy projects.
20% Analyze effectiveness of energy efficiency initiatives by compiling and synthesizing data from various sources via appropriate tools (Excel, Access) Use software toolsets in energy management systems to identify issues.
10% Support efforts with third party to acquire rebates for qualifying energy efficiency projects.
10% Conduct analysis on outlier stores to determine root cause of excess electricity and/or water usage.
10% Support purchase activity in deregulated electricity and gas markets.
